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service Albuquerque NM
710 PM MDT Sun Aug 16 2026

The National Weather Service in Albuquerque has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  Central Union County in northeastern New Mexico...

* Until 800 PM MDT.

* At 710 PM MD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 20 miles south of
  Mount Dora, or 21 miles southwest of Clayton, moving north at 10
  mph.

  H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and half dollar size hail.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age to
           roofs, siding, and trees.

* Locations impacted include...
  Mainly rural areas of Central Union County.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Seek shelter inside a well-built structure and stay away from
windows. This storm is capable of producing damaging winds and large
hail.

Torrential rainfall is also occurring with this storm and may lead to
flash fl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
